コード例 #1
0
 @Nullable
 @Override
 public JComponent createComponent() {
   if (mySettingsPane == null) {
     mySettingsPane = new DiffSettingsPanel();
   }
   return mySettingsPane.getPanel();
 }
コード例 #2
0
 @Override
 public void reset() {
   if (mySettingsPane != null) {
     mySettingsPane.reset();
   }
 }
コード例 #3
0
 @Override
 public void apply() throws ConfigurationException {
   if (mySettingsPane != null) {
     mySettingsPane.apply();
   }
 }
コード例 #4
0
 @Override
 public boolean isModified() {
   return mySettingsPane != null && mySettingsPane.isModified();
 }